Output 68d58ecf20d7f54939992bee66aeb637d0513695e46260542e85872b9cd6cba1:0

value
28600000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 207bbb453b0c7e20dcd4551987cb1a3d940a7ddc OP_EQUALVERIFY OP_CHECKSIG
address
13xkrA2dAPnPLZkX1c4Z9CvwbU1w7n7wx8
transaction
68d58ecf20d7f54939992bee66aeb637d0513695e46260542e85872b9cd6cba1
spent
true